ON Semiconductor ADP3416JR Dual Bootstrapped 12 V MOSFET Driver with Output Disable
The ADP3416JR is a versatile dual MOSFET driver designed to drive two N-channel MOSFETs in a synchronous buck power stage. Manufactured by ON Semiconductor, a leading innovator in energy-efficient electronics, this driver is optimized for converting power in a wide range of applications, from computing and networking to telecommunications and industrial systems.
Key Features:
- Bootstrapped High-Side Drive: The ADP3416JR is capable of driving high-side MOSFETs with a bootstrapped supply voltage, ensuring efficient operation even at high switching frequencies.
- Adaptive Nonoverlap Control: To prevent shoot-through current in the power stage, the driver features adaptive nonoverlap control, which adjusts the timing of the high-side and low-side drives.
- Output Disable Function: An output disable function allows for the immediate shutdown of the MOSFETs, providing an extra layer of protection and power management.
- Wide Supply Range: The driver operates with a supply voltage range from 10 V to 20 V, accommodating various system requirements.
- High Peak Current Capability: With its ability to handle peak currents up to 2 A, the ADP3416JR can effectively drive large MOSFETs that require high current for fast switching.

The ADP3416JR is offered in a compact SOIC-8 package, making it suitable for space-constrained applications.
